sql >> Database >  >> NoSQL >> MongoDB

Mongoose Populate werkt niet met Array of ObjectIds

Ik heb het werkend gekregen door het model te hernoemen (het derde argument):

mongoose.model( "Profiles", profile, "Profiles" );

Het probleem was dat Mongoose op zoek was naar profiles collectie, maar het is daar als Profiles in databank. Dus hernoemde ik het naar Profiles overeenkomen met de exacte naam.

Pfff! Dankzij mij.




  1. Ik probeer een bulk-upsert te doen met Mongoose. Wat is de schoonste manier om dit te doen?

  2. Alle veldnamen in een mongodb-verzameling krijgen?

  3. Hoe kan ik het oplossen van de mislukte sockets instellen tijdens het opstarten wanneer ik de mongodb-server gebruik?

  4. MongoDB sorteren op kinderen